Blue Mountain Christian University Names Grace Swanson Assistant Volleyball Coach

Blue Mountain Christian University has announced the hiring of Grace Swanson as the new assistant coach for its volleyball team, the Volley Toppers.

Swanson, a native of Corinth, Mississippi, joins BMCU after coaching at the high school and club levels. She played for Corinth High School’s inaugural volleyball team in 2009 and earned All-Division honors. Swanson helped lead the Warriors to a division championship and a North Half Championship appearance in 2012.

Following her playing career, Swanson gained four years of coaching experience outside Mississippi before returning to Corinth High School as head coach in 2023. Under her leadership, Corinth reached the MHSAA playoffs in 2023 and 2024, the program’s first postseason appearances since 2019.

Swanson has also contributed to the volleyball community across Mississippi. In 2024, she was selected to coach the Northeast Mississippi Volleyball Coaches Association 4A-7A All-Star Game. She has served as head coach for Core Volleyball for three years, focusing on athlete development through club volleyball.

“We are excited to welcome Grace to our volleyball family,” said BMCU head coach Sara Eason. “Her passion for investing in student-athletes and helping them succeed both on and off the court makes her a great fit for our program. We believe she will make a positive impact from day one.”

Swanson holds an associate’s degree from Northeast Mississippi Community College and a Bachelor of Science in Sports Coaching from the University of Southern Mississippi. She plans to pursue a master’s degree in Sport and Coaching Performance at Southern Miss starting this August.
